Freshman Caroline Dupont was named the Sports Imports/American Volleyball Coaches Association Division III National Player of the Week. A middle hitter from Leawood, Kan., Dupont led Washington University to the WU/ASICS National Invitational crown over the weekend and was also selected to the All-Tournament Team.
